SAN DIEGO — Science fiction writers Harlan Ellison and Robert Silverberg; cartoonists B. Kliban and Sergio Aragones and comic-book artist Jack Kirby are all part of the San Diego Comic-Con running through Sunday at the Convention and Performing Arts Center.
More than 7,000 people are expected to attend the event, which includes panel discussions, exhibits from comic-book companies, films and a costume contest.
Admission is $12 for adults, $6 for children 7 to 16 and free for those younger than 7.
